原文:PostgreSQL的架构

是最先进的数据库。他的第一个版本在 年发布,从那时开始,他得到了很多扩展。根据db enginers上的排名情况,PostgreSQL目前在数据库领域排名第四。 本篇博客,我们来讨论一下PostgreSQL的内部架构,以及各个组件之间如何交互。这将是本期PostgreSQL DBA系列博客的基石。 一 PostgreSQL的架构 PostgreSQL的物理架构非常简单,它由共享内存 一系列后台进程 ...

2019-11-08 18:29 0 824 推荐指数:

查看详情

postgresql架构基础(转)-(1)

PostgreSQL使用一种客户端/服务器的模型。一次PostgreSQL会话由下列相关的进程(程序)组成: 一个服务器进程,它管理数据库文件、接受来自客户端应用与数据库的联接并且代表客户端在数据库上执行操作。 该数据库服务器程序叫做postgres。 那些需要执行数据库操作 ...

Fri Jul 07 23:07:00 CST 2017 0 1201
PostgreSQL的几种分布式架构对比

PostgreSQL由于强大的功能和良好的扩展性,基于PostgreSQL来做的分布式架构也比较多,大部分用于分析类场景,下面比较几种常见的架构特点。 Citus Citus以插件的方式扩展到PostgreSQL中,独立于PostgreSQL内核,所以能很快的跟上 ...

Thu Jun 11 22:29:00 CST 2020 0 679
PolarDB PostgreSQL 架构原理解读

背景 PolarDB PostgreSQL(以下简称PolarDB)是一款阿里云自主研发的企业级数据库产品,采用计算存储分离架构,兼容PostgreSQL与Oracle。PolarDB 的存储与计算能力均可横向扩展,具有高可靠、高可用、弹性扩展等企业级数据库特性。同时,PolarDB 具有大规模 ...

Mon Sep 27 22:06:00 CST 2021 0 250
PostgreSQL分布式架构之——PL/Proxy

1. PL/Proxy的介绍 1.1 PL/Proxy概述   PL/Proxy是一款能在PostgreSQL数据库实现数据库水平拆分的软件;可以理解分布式架构(shared nothing);但是不是真正的分布式数据库软件;也是一款能在PostgreSQL数据库实现SQL语言复制 ...

Thu Jun 14 22:20:00 CST 2018 0 8196
分布式 PostgreSQL - Citus 架构及概念

节点 Citus 是一种 PostgreSQL 扩展,它允许数据库服务器(称为节点)在“无共享(shared nothing)”架构中相互协调。这些节点形成一个集群,允许 PostgreSQL 保存比单台计算机上更多的数据和使用更多的 CPU 内核。 这种架构还允许通过简单地向集群添加更多 ...

Mon Mar 07 06:27:00 CST 2022 0 1059
【赵强老师】史上最详细的PostgreSQL体系架构介绍

PostgreSQL是最像Oracle的开源数据库,我们可以拿Oracle来比较学习它的体系结构,比较容易理解。PostgreSQL的主要结构如下: 一、存储结构 PG数据存储结构分为:逻辑存储结构和物理存储存储。其中:逻辑存储结构是内部的组织和管理数据的方式;物理存储结构是操作系统中 ...

Tue Sep 07 20:25:00 CST 2021 0 183
postgresql

一、介绍 PostgreSQL是以加州大学伯克利分校计算机系开发的 POSTGRES,现在已经更名为PostgreSQL,版本 4.2为基础的对象关系型数据库管理系统(ORDBMS)。PostgreSQL支持大部分 SQL标准并且提供了许多其他现代特性:复杂查询、外键、触发器、视图、事务完整性 ...

Sat Nov 06 01:12:00 CST 2021 0 195
 
粤ICP备18138465号  © 2018-2026 CODEPRJ.COM